Who you will be writing to

Walt Whitman was a Brooklyn printer, schoolteacher, and newspaperman who self-published Leaves of Grass in 1855 and set some of the type himself. During the Civil War he spent years visiting wounded soldiers in Washington hospitals, bringing small gifts and writing letters home for men who could not.

That is the Whitman you correspond with: large-hearted, unhurried, endlessly interested in ordinary people. He finds the ferry ride, the lilac, and the passing stranger all equally worth a paragraph.
